Airport Transfer Buses Between Palm Coast and DAB, JAX, or MCO
Palm Coast sits at a geographic crossroads that makes airport logistics genuinely complicated for corporate groups. Daytona Beach International Airport (DAB) is roughly 30 miles south on I-95 — about 35 to 45 minutes off-peak, longer during Daytona race weekends when southbound I-95 slows to a crawl near Exit 261. Jacksonville International Airport (JAX) is approximately 60 miles north, a 65- to 80-minute run depending on morning peak traffic through the I-95/I-295 interchange.
Orlando International Airport (MCO) is about 90 miles south. Coordinating a caravan of rental cars across any of those distances costs more than one charter bus and takes far longer. A 56-passenger motorcoach with undercarriage luggage bays loads everyone at a single Palm Coast pickup point and delivers the group curbside at the terminal.

At Jacksonville International Airport, buses and commercial vans use the free Pre-arranged Ground Transportation Facility on the north side of the terminal near baggage claim; passenger pickup from the hourly garage or public curb is prohibited. Your bus waits in that designated facility, then loads everyone together at the airport instead of circling the terminal road.

Bus parking at Daytona International Speedway is in **Lot 1** on a first-come, first-served basis, with **Lot 6** used as the overflow when Lot 1 fills. Your bus drops everyone at the speedway, parks in the assigned bus lot, and avoids sending the whole client group through separate car entrances.

Book at least three to four months out for Daytona 500 weekend in February and Bike Week in March — both events pull enormous demand from Palm Coast, Ormond Beach, and the entire I-95 corridor simultaneously. Waiting until the month of the event means higher rates and very limited vehicle availability. For recurring employee shuttles or standard corporate runs outside peak event dates, two to four weeks of lead time is generally workable, though earlier is always better for vehicle selection.
The next published race calendar puts Speedweeks at February 13–21, 2027, with the DAYTONA 500 on February 21, 2027, and Bike Week at March 5–14, 2027; those dates are on the Daytona International Speedway 2027 event calendar.
